Council to get £43,078 funding
This follows on from the minister’s announcement in January that there will be no reduction in the Rates Support Grant for councils in the next financial year 2016/17.
Mr Durkan said: “I am now able to allocate a further £700,000 to the rates support Grant budget this year. This further amount, coupled with £2.1million already distributed to councils in October 2015, is good news for councils and ratepayers. This follows on from my announcement in January that I have, despite a large cut in the DOE budget, found the money to protect the level of the Rates Support Grant payable to councils next year. This £700,000 will be further welcome news for councils.”
